    Ok so i start to decypt my dvd with DVD decypter and it always gets about 50 percent done and gives me a read error. i can hit cancel and it keeps going or retry and it keeps giving me the error. what could solve this? thanks

    @jamestheg,

    I'm assuming you're using the Mode, Iso, Read R to rip or decrypt your movie into your hard drive right? I highly recommend using the Mode, File F to rip/decrypt to your hard drive - it's more safer and more likely to have a successfully ripped. Please check the following "settings" on your DVD Decrypter:

    at CSS
    [tick or check] on Brute Force --> I/O key exchange
    On Failure: use key from another file: Yes?

    at I/O
    [tick or check] on Ignore read errors

    at General
    [tick or check] on Remove Macrovision Protection
    at Removal Method: Aggressive

    at "ISO Read Mode" and "File Mode"
    [tick or check] on all of the Remove Protections
